Cultural References
Bart chooses to read the Robert Louis Stevenson novel Treasure Island for his book report, while Martin reads Ernest Hemingway's The Old Man and the Sea. During "Snow Day", the citizens of Springfield sing "Winter Wonderland". The scene where everyone in Springfield gathers around the town circle, holds hands and begins singing is a reference to How the Grinch Stole Christmas!. "Hallelujah", the chorus from George Frideric Handel's Messiah, can be heard when it starts snowing.
